I think I'm gonna go try some more from photo work and overlay it in when i start shading (Seems quite useful for that at least) [/QUOTE] The point of learning the major planes is to understand the shape of the face and its features better. It's less about learning how to draw a face and more about learning what you're drawing. Learning the planes definitely helped me a lot. [QUOTE=kirederf7;44649113]Yeah I know, was going for a general feel though. Oh the planet on the background is actually Earth. So it's more like a satellite city. Can you enlighten me on how to do the reflections correctly?[/QUOTE] Well, have a look at this, I'll try to simplify it all as much as possible for my own sake :v: [img]http://i.gyazo.com/efd2e173237e4a860b3fa757ab1adc78.png[/img] The green lines represent the extended horizontal plane of that platform on which you have the reflections. I've done this to help you visually make the distinction in distance that I'm gonna talk about next. The building I've outlined in blue and its reflection make for the best or easiest to understand example of what's wrong here, but it applies to the others as well. So, physically what you are trying to depict here should look orthographically something like this (except the platform would be much smaller and much further away but no matter): [img]http://i.gyazo.com/ed54c200fa1ae83fa15e09548af93f14.png[/img] The light radiating from a single window in the skyscraper comes [I][B]down[/B][/I] onto the platform across a huge gulf of open space and bounces back up into our "camera". Now, if the window/light source drops below the GREEN line, that light source will no longer be capable of casting a reflection on the top surface of the platform for us to see. Refer back to the picture itself - notice I've put a red mark arbitrarily along a green line stretching toward the buildings. How far away from the platform do you suppose that is? A hundred metres or more? It's a good way away but it's only a fraction of the distance from the platform to the buildings, right? Now consider how much higher up that red mark is spatially above the building I outlined in blue. Imagine continuing the green line until it was flush with the building. It's waay up above the rooftop. So is the platform, being on the same plane. We're looking down onto the platform, and way off in the distance shrouded in atmospheric perspective is this building, of which we can SEE the rooftop. If you put the platform next to the building, the platform would be a few [I]thousand[/I] metres higher than its roof. So basically the only way those buildings could cast those reflections is if they were literally a cardboard cutout positioned like this: [img]http://i.gyazo.com/1a694974d072f917c0e439e62fc366ac.png[/img]
